The light emitted by space dots can tell us a great deal about the objects themselves. By studying the spectrum of light produced by a space dot, astronomers can determine its composition, temperature, age, and distance from Earth. This valuable information allows scientists to piece together a more complete picture of the objects that make up our universe, from newborn stars and planets to ancient galaxies and black holes.

One of the most important roles that space dots play in astronomy is as distance markers. Because space dots emit light, they can be used to measure the vast distances between celestial objects in the universe. By comparing the brightness of a space dot as seen from Earth to its actual luminosity, astronomers can calculate how far away it is. This technique, known as the cosmic distance ladder, has been instrumental in determining the size and age of the universe.
